How To Fix RS_ADSO_MODEL147 - The interval value of partition '&1' is too long. Max length: '&2'.


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: RS_ADSO_MODEL - Messages related to the Datastore Object Backend

  • Message number: 147

  • Message text: The interval value of partition '&1' is too long. Max length: '&2'.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message RS_ADSO_MODEL147 - The interval value of partition '&1' is too long. Max length: '&2'. ?

    The SAP error message RS_ADSO_MODEL147 indicates that there is an issue with the partitioning of an Advanced DataStore Object (ADSO) in SAP BW/4HANA or SAP BW on HANA. Specifically, it means that the interval value for a partition exceeds the maximum allowed length.

    Cause:

    The error occurs when the defined interval for a partition in the ADSO is too long. Each partition in an ADSO can have a defined range of values (e.g., date ranges), and if the length of this range exceeds the maximum allowed length, the system will throw this error. The maximum length is typically defined by the system settings or the specific configuration of the ADSO.

    Solution:

    To resolve this error, you can take the following steps:

    1. Review Partitioning Settings:

      • Go to the ADSO settings in the SAP BW modeling tools.
      • Check the partitioning settings and the defined intervals for each partition.
    2. Adjust Interval Values:

      • If you find that the interval value for the partition is indeed too long, consider adjusting it to fit within the maximum allowed length. This may involve:
        • Reducing the range of values.
        • Splitting the partition into smaller intervals if necessary.
    3. Check Maximum Length:

      • Verify the maximum length allowed for the partition interval in your system. This can usually be found in the documentation or system settings.
    4. Re-activate the ADSO:

      • After making the necessary adjustments, you may need to re-activate the ADSO to apply the changes.
    5. Test the Changes:

      • After re-activating, test the data loading or processing to ensure that the error no longer occurs.
